figured it out after about an hour and a half haha. you have to remove the whole fuse unit.. there are two clips and the black covering comes off. then u have to remove the yellow casing which the fuses sit in.. you gotta go under it and there are 4 small clips u use a flat head screw driver. the yellow casing just slides right out. then the alternator fuse has two ground wires on both sides with philips screws. unscrew those and wallah! and by the way u dont have to remove any fuse links
